Top 5 Dance Games on Android in Czech Republic Q1 2022
In Q1 2022, the top 5 dance games on Android in the Czech Republic showed varied trends in weekly downloads, revenue, and active users. Sensor Tower provides detailed insights into these trends.
Throughout the first quarter of 2022, the top 5 dance games on the Android platform in the Czech Republic exhibited a range of performance metrics. Below, we delve into the weekly downloads, revenue, and active user trends for each of these top-performing apps.
Pole Star from CrazyLabs LTD saw fluctuating weekly downloads, starting with 1.7K in late December and ending with 775 in late March. Weekly active users followed a similar trend, beginning at 1.6K and closing the quarter at 815.
Ice Skating Ballerina Life by Coco Play By TabTale experienced relatively stable weekly downloads, starting at 699 and ending at 269. Revenue peaked at $13 in early March, while weekly active users saw a decline from 955 at the start to 405 by the end of the quarter.
Dance Clash: Ballet vs Hip Hop, also from Coco Play By TabTale, showed consistent weekly downloads around 350 to 400 throughout the quarter. The app's revenue saw a notable peak of $21 in early February, and active users remained steady, fluctuating around 650 to 700.
Just Dance Now by Ubisoft Entertainment had its highest weekly downloads at 500 in late December, dropping to around 190 by the end of March. Revenue peaked at $293 in early January, and weekly active users decreased from 756 to 414 over the quarter.
My Town: Dance School Fun Game from My Town Games Ltd had more stable metrics, with weekly downloads ranging from 142 to 196 and active users fluctuating between 97 and 123 throughout Q1 2022.
